Output c75f571ae86a2900b85cffc52f2624a214acb5d059b9f3e81bfd5d4022122165:2

value
14868082
script pubkey
OP_0 OP_PUSHBYTES_20 1a50fe75ee842e0f77b3116891755a4e2f837e17
address
ltc1qrfg0ua0wsshq7aanz95fza26fchcxlshg3uxna
transaction
c75f571ae86a2900b85cffc52f2624a214acb5d059b9f3e81bfd5d4022122165
spent
true